The Wave
Day-to-day the lineup favors longer-period W-NW groundswell with light E-SE winds for glassy conditions and usually rides best on incoming to high tides.
A photogenic half-mile sand beach that can peel surprisingly hollow rights and lefts but often delivers heavy shorepound when the West swell lines up. Get the latest surfing conditions, forecast, and tide details for Carmel Beach in California.

Heavy shorepound and shifting peaks along the half-mile bank make getting caught inside the chief local hazard.
Parking is tight on weekends.
